Mathematics Question on linear inequalities
x−3x+4<2 is satisfied when x satisfies
A
(−∞,3)∪(10,∞)
B
(3,10)
C
(−∞,3)∪[10,∞)
D
None of these
Answer
(−∞,3)∪(10,∞)
Explanation
Solution
We have, x−3x+4<2 or x−3x+4−2<0 or x−3−x+10<0 or x−3x−10>0 ⇒ \\{x - 10 > 0 and x-3>0\\} or \\{ x - 10<0 and x-3<0\\} \Rightarrow \quad \\{x > 10 and x > 3\\} or \\{x < 10 and x < 3\\} ⇒x∈(−∞,3)∪(10,∞)
